Output 73c8f86dcaae70b4d25dd7e2d3296cdd934368ae469dffebb196b874ebeae49a:1

value
6099346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222ec82e323d76e3938bfa12e105e5f9c88637bb OP_EQUAL
address
34okwXswB4jhh1M4UyYyj9yMcE8J4uxSNC
transaction
73c8f86dcaae70b4d25dd7e2d3296cdd934368ae469dffebb196b874ebeae49a
confirmations
42174
spent
true